Healthcare as a relational activity calls us always to be able to work alongside others in our care. However, there are times when quite naturally our care of others comes as a burden to us. Care can be costly and we can feel its impact. The good news is that this is perfectly normal! Being able to recognise this helps us to be proactive in staying well in our work and care of others.
Professional supervision provides just such a place to be able to safely share the impact of care with a trusted professional to help us to regain perspective, stay well and even more, to flourish. A professional supervisory session provides some shelter for us to look at what is important away from the pressures of work. This shelter allows new areas to grow and find strength within us.
